#6ce566 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6ce566 is composed of 42.4% red, 89.8%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.5%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 117.2 degrees, a saturation of 70.9% and a lightness of 64.9%. #6ce566 color hex could be obtained by blending #d8ffcc with #00cb00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#6ce566
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f02 is the darkest color, while #fdfffd is the lightest one.
